How to Decorate a Heart Cookie
Prepare the following items:
2 Tipless Piping Bags
Super Red Food Coloring
Spatulas & pint glasses to fill your piping bags
Scissors
Step 1: Bake and cool cookies before decorating. Make sure cookies are fully cooled. If they are warm, the icing will run off of them. Make royal icing. Learn how to mix different consistencies of royal icing here>>
Prepare the following icing colors:
Piping Consistency:
Red
Flood Consistency:
Red
Step 2: Cut the tip off of your disposable piping bag. Make sure you leave a small tip for precision when piping.

Step 3: With your piping consistency icing, carefully pipe a border around your heart. You may be able to achieve more stability by placing your non-dominant hand on the wrist of your piping hand for smoother piping.

Step 4: Once the outline is complete, stop squeezing and lift your piping bag, making sure that you have formed a complete border around the heart shape.


Step 5: Time to flood! With your flood consistency royal icing, fill in your heart shape. Apply the icing liberally, making sure to fill in the center.


Step 6: Using a toothpick, gently move the flood icing around while it is still wet. Ensure that the entire cookie is filled with icing. The border you created earlier will keep the icing from spilling over the side of the cookie.

And you're done! These simple heart cookies will make a big impact for Valentine's Day.
